I got my front breaks changed here. When I got my car back the steering wheel started shaking. It got to the point where I found the vehicle unsafe to drive. I did some research online and found that can be caused by loose lug nuts. Sure enough, I checked the lug nuts on the driver's side tire. Three out of the five I took off with my hand. They were never torqued. The tire could've come off on the freeway and then I might not be here to leave this review. I called meineke up and told them what I found. The man on the phone was totally unhelpful. First, he tried to assure me that they took my car for a test drive. Then he kept asking me what I wanted him to do about it. He didn't offer any sort of refund, or offer to speak to the mechanic about the oversight. He did offer to tighten my lug nuts if I drove my vehicle down to them (not safe). The conversation ended with him saying "What do you want me to do about it?" and I told him that I was going to leave a negative review online because people should know about this. It was then that he hung up on me. My voice wasn't raised. I was direct but still respectful. I've never been hung up on by a professional. I contacted corporate. They got in touch with the owner who offered to torque my lug nuts and teach me how to use some lug nut torque tool. I torqued the lug nuts correctly, it was their mechanic that forgot to torque them.
